WEATHER
Bright and breezy.
Today:
Rather cloudy at times with a little rain about but generally becoming brighter through the morning with some sunny spells developing. However cloud increasing during the afternoon bringing more persistent rain to Kintyre later. Strong southeasterly winds with coastal gales.
Tonight:
Cloudy with outbreaks of rain spreading across the area through the evening, turning more persistent and occasionally heavy, especially for Argyll. Remaining windy with coastal gales.
Tuesday:
A wet start with some heavy rain around but brighter conditions with a few heavy showers soon reaching Ayrshire then spreading to most parts through the day. Winds easing.
Outlook for Wednesday to Friday:
Sunny spells and slow moving showers on Wednesday and Thursday, heavy with a risk of thunder. Showers on Friday expected to merge to give more persistent, occasionally heavy, rain.
